USB-I2C is implemented using the USB and I2C components of PSoC 5LP. The SCL (P12_0) and
SDA (P12_1) lines from the PSoC 5LP are connected to SCL (P3_0) and SDA (P3_1) lines of the
PSoC 4 I2C. The USB-I2C bridge currently supports I2C speed of 50 kHz, 100 kHz, 400 kHz, and
1MHz.
Refer to Using PSoC 5LP as USB-I2C Bridge on page 76 for building a project, which uses USB-I2C
Bridge functionality.
3.5 Updating the Onboard Programmer Firmware
The firmware of the onboard programmer and debugger, PSoC 5LP, can be updated from PSoC
Programmer. When a new firmware is available or when the KitProg firmware is corrupt (see Error in
Firmware/Status Indication in Status LED on page 107), PSoC Programmer displays a warning
indicating that new firmware is available.
Open PSoC Programmer from Start > All Programs > Cypress > PSoC Programmer<version>.
When PSoC Programmer opens, a WARNING! window pops up saying that the programmer is
currently out of date.
